    I cannot stress enough how utterly unique this was... it was a novella that came as digital media, a collaboration with the goth metal band Moonspell. its a whole work of art, music and book, coincide beautifully, but the book by itself would be worth reading. It is as potent an expression of emotion as i have ever read. amazing. totally unconventional. i'm not sure if you can get just the book somehow, but as i suggested on another thread, it would be worth buying the album just for the book. wow. one line, i wrote down, because it struck such a chord in me:

    "The sound of the world existing, like a choir of silences."
